Position Summary
Performs any one or combination of related material handling activities. Operates forklift to complete material movement, loads/unloads, sorts and stores materials/products onto pallets and carts. Picks, issues, counts, labels raw materials and work in process (WIP) to the production lines and back to stock. Inspects documentation for conformity. Operates a computer and provides back up for all related jobs.

Minimum Qualifications, Education & Experience
- Must be at least 18 years of age.
- High school graduate or equivalent.
- Two years' experience working in a materials or manufacturing environment preferred.
Work Environment
- Manufacturing environment.
- Must wear hearing protection, safety shoes, prescription glasses (if prescribed) and any/all personal protective equipment (PPE) required to perform job in assigned areas.
- Conveyance of loaded or empty material racks, loads can weigh as much as 900 pounds. Repetitive lifting of up to 50 pounds is not uncommon.
- Ability to push carts containing heavy loads and able to lift materials weighing up to 50 lbs. unassisted.
- Typically requires travel less than 5% of the time
